Most prescription drug plans designate certain pharmacies as “preferred pharmacies” where
you will get the lowest prices. Your current Express Scripts Medicare-Saver plan has designated
both CVS and Walmart as preferred pharmacies. The Wellcare Wellness Rx PDP, on the other
hand, has designated Walmart but not CVS as a preferred pharmacy in your area.
It’s possible that the Wellcare Wellness Rx Plan has other preferred pharmacies in your area,
but there’s no easy way to know that because the Medicare web site no longer lists all a plan’s
preferred pharmacies. If you want to see if this plan has other preferred pharmacies nearby,
you can call the Wellcare Wellness plan’s enrollment number below and ask.
